Açaï pops

Açai pops

Frozen Cashew and Acai Popsicles Recipe by Clémence Catz , culinary author and photographer. Soaking: 4 hours Preparation : 10 min. Rest : 12 hours For a dozen mini ice creams (or 4 to 6 large ones). STEP 1: INGREDIENTS Products in orange are available in our Sol Semilla store via the “ Related Products » at the bottom of the page. – 150 g cashew nuts (soaked for 4 hours) – 120 g of agave syrup – 1/2 tsp vanilla extract – 1 level teaspoon of powdered ginger – 1 tbsp. rum (optional) – 2 tbsp. acai powder – 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ice Options: fresh or frozen blueberries, blue poppy seeds or black sesame seeds… STEP 2: RECIPE Rinse the cashew nuts and blend them for a long time with 250 g of fresh water, at maximum power. Add the agave syrup, vanilla, ginger and rum and blend for another minute or two, until the mixture is completely smooth and homogeneous. Pour 150 g of cream into a bowl and mix (or blend) with the açaï and lemon juice. Alternate the two preparations in Eskimo molds, adding blueberries and sesame or blue poppy seeds if desired. Place in the freezer until the ice creams have set (about twelve hours), then store them in a container in the freezer and consume within two weeks.

Lucumatcha: A New Super Latte Coming

A blend of flavors and benefits Lucumatcha is a blend of matcha , Japanese green tea powder & Lucuma powder, a fruit from the Peruvian Amazon. This synergy is interesting on two levels: taste & nutrition . Matcha, through the selection of young tea leaves, has a high antioxidant content , a so-called " Umami " taste with light bitter and sometimes even herbaceous notes. Lucuma, on the other hand, is full of B vitamins and provides a mild and slightly sweet flavor. It has the power to thicken our preparations a little, making our vegetable lattes creamier than ever. The Lucuma Fruit cut in half, harvested by Marie in Peru " Together, they form a perfect balance ," says Marie Rousset (product development & sourcing at Sol Semilla) who created this new drink. " Indeed, in addition to providing vitamins & fiber, Lucuma softens the sometimes slightly too bitter taste of Matcha, making it even easier to drink! I recommend mixing it with rice or oat milk! " A historic cultural marriage Peru and Japan have been very close. The Peruvian government in 1899 offered Japanese farmers to cultivate land on the coast. Peru even had a president of Japanese origin. Nikkei culture is therefore very present in Peru, particularly in the cuisine, ceviche or "leche de tigre", dishes of marinated raw fish reminiscent of Japanese culinary art (sashimi). “ Lucumatcha therefore echoes the history of this beautiful cultural marriage ,” explains Marie, who has travelled to both countries.
